Job Description

We are currently looking for a Trades or Technical individual to join us in the role of Data Centre Technician working within our facilities team operating on a 24/7 basis. 

Within this entry-level role, we will provide full on-the-job training to bring you up to speed on all aspects of data centre facility management and critical infrastructure, including Cooling, Electrical, Cabling Infrastructure, Building Monitoring, and Fire systems. 

Based in Port Melbourne, the purpose of this role is to support the Facility Management team with the day-to-day operations of the data centre, by providing high quality & efficient technical maintenance and customer service. 

  • The successful candidate will be required to work a 4 – 5 – 5 rotating shift roster with day shifts from 7am - 7pm and night shifts from 7pm - 7am. 

Key Responsibilities include: 

  • Delivery of cabling needs, electrical and data, to customer racks and areas 
  • Attend to Remote Hands requests 
  • Assist with vendor management for maintenance of all core electrical and mechanical systems 
  • Ensure that facility problems are identified and resolved in a timely manner 
  • Monitor building management / monitoring systems 24/7, and quickly and effectively escalate issues internally or to vendors as relevant 
  • Ensure all visitors and contractors adhere to NEXTDC facility rules. 
  • Manual handling 

This role is not focused on IT but leans more towards a hands-on facility management position, involving practical tasks and operational responsibilities 

From time to time, during shifts there may be travel between sites as required. 

Qualifications
  • Excellent customer service, communication skills and a 'can do' attitude 
  • Basic knowledge of data centres, data cabling and cable management (Desirable) 
  • A passion for learning about telecommunications and how things work 
  • Keen interest in fixing and solving problems 
  • TAFE Cert in Telecommunications (desirable) 
  • Trade Certs (Electrician/HVAC Technician) (desirable) 

Candidates MUST be Australian Citizens due to security clearances required
